Heavy duty workbench castors represent a crucial component in industrial mobility solutions, engineered to support substantial loads while ensuring smooth movement and operational safety. These robust wheels are specifically designed to withstand intense daily use in manufacturing facilities, warehouses, and workshops. Featuring high-grade steel construction and precision bearings, these castors can support weights ranging from 200 to 1000 kg per wheel, depending on the model. The castors incorporate advanced swivel technology that enables 360-degree rotation, facilitating effortless maneuverability of heavy workbenches in confined spaces. Their durability is enhanced through specialized heat treatment processes and protective coatings that resist corrosion and wear. The wheel materials typically include polyurethane or solid rubber, offering excellent floor protection while maintaining high load capacity. Many models feature integrated braking systems for secure positioning during work operations, combining mobility with stability when needed. These castors are designed with ergonomic considerations, reducing the force required for initial movement and maintaining smooth rolling resistance throughout operation.

Superior Load Capacity and Stability

Superior Load Capacity and Stability

The exceptional load-bearing capability of heavy duty workbench castors sets them apart in the industrial mobility sector. Each castor is engineered with reinforced mounting plates and precision-machined components that ensure even weight distribution and structural integrity under extreme loads. The innovative double-ball bearing design enhances stability while maintaining smooth rotation, even when supporting maximum weight capacity. The wide wheel base provides additional stability, preventing tipping or uneven movement during transportation. The high-grade materials used in construction, including hardened steel and industrial-grade polymers, guarantee long-term performance without deformation or structural compromise.
Advanced Braking System Technology

Advanced Braking System Technology

The sophisticated braking mechanism incorporated into these heavy duty castors represents a significant advancement in workbench mobility control. The dual-action brake system enables both wheel and swivel lock functions, providing complete immobilization when required. The brake engagement mechanism is designed for easy operation while wearing work gloves, featuring an ergonomic foot-operated lever that requires minimal force to activate. The braking components are manufactured from wear-resistant materials, ensuring consistent performance over thousands of brake engagement cycles. The system includes fail-safe features that prevent accidental release, maintaining workplace safety standards.
Enhanced Maneuverability and Floor Protection

Enhanced Maneuverability and Floor Protection

The innovative design of these castors prioritizes both mobility and surface protection through advanced engineering solutions. The precision-machined swivel bearing assembly enables smooth rotation with minimal effort, while the specially formulated wheel compounds provide optimal floor contact without marking or damaging surfaces. The wheel tread pattern is designed to maintain traction while preventing debris accumulation, ensuring consistent performance in various industrial environments. The integrated shock-absorption system reduces vibration transmission, protecting both the workbench contents and the floor surface during movement. The wheel design incorporates self-cleaning features that maintain performance even in debris-laden environments.
